ELEPHANTS WAIT AS FIREFIGHTERS PUT OUT TRACTOR-TRAILER FIRE
Elephants were waiting for Chattanooga firefighters when they arrived to a vehicle fire on I-24 near the Georgia state line this morning (Monday, November 20, 2017). Yes, you read that first sentence right. Officers say a tractor-trailer carrying three African elephants caught fire about 2 a.m. this morning. According to authorities the tractor was on fire, but the trailer was not. The owners got the elephants safely out of the trailer and gave them some hay to munch on while firefighters put the fire out. With the fire out, the owners made some calls to get another tractor to their location. A few hours later, the elephants were safely loaded on another tractor-trailer to continue their journey to Sarasota, Florida.
